
Trick-or-Treat! Or so you thought? Halloween night, last year, Weston Norris lost his daughter. This year, he plans on avoiding the night as the Trick or Treaters come knocking. But, once you sit alone in the screamingly silent darkness on Halloween night, you’ll truly learn what goes bump in the night.

I like the premise of the game and was interested in trying it out, but I had performance issues with the game, where my controls would suddenly stop working, and I would be frozen in place. Soon after, the screen just goes black and nothing happens, almost as if it froze. You hear the sounds and everything going on, but there is no picture. You can hit escape to try to get to the main menu or pause screen, but nothing happens. I would reboot the game and start again, and I would experience the same issue. I thought it would be fun to record an episode of this for my channel, but in its current state, the game has been unplayable. I'm hopeful the developers can make whatever fix is necessary. However, I can't at this point recommend the game until I can see it is at least working and playable.
